Uniaxial high temperature accelerometer Type 8205B... 3. Product description Basic execution Sensor type 8205B… is a 2wire, internally ground isolated differential piezoelectric accelerometer. The sensor is avail able with integrated cable options with different levels of protection. Execution for operation in hazardous areas (Ex-Versions) The sensor is available for operaion in hazardous areas.

Operation For proper operation it is necessary to first determine whether the sensor is installed in a potentially explosive atmosphere. 4.1 General instructions for operation The following instructions regarding the installation and operation must be followed: The sensor is hermetically sealed. The integral cable meets ingress protection ≥IP54 and must be protected against adverse environmental effects where necessary.

Operation 4.3.5 Intrinsically safe equipment (Ex-ia) 4.3.5.1 Intrinsically safe measuring chain (Ex - version) The sensor can be used in intrinsically safe circuits in Zones 0, 1 or 2. For operation in potentially explosive environments the sen sor must be operated with an Excertified differential charge amplifier and an appropriate Excertified barrier.
